For the S6231, the hard drive is very easy to upgrade, however this is not considered a user upgradeable part according to Fujitsu and could technically void your warranty if something were to go wrong. Just some information that I picked up on when I got my notebook.
Forgot to mention, I upgraded my Fujitsu's hard drive but was told if I ever needed to send my notebook in for repair, to put back the old HD before I send it in so I don't void the warranty
